What is the migration inflow in Atlantic?

The migration inflow in Atlantic is 3,651, which ranks #352 of 2,753 U.S. counties. Curb Report updates this monthly and it is free to view.

Is the migration inflow in Atlantic above or below the national average?

Atlantic is higher than the U.S. median of 399, putting it in the top 13% of U.S. counties.

How does Atlantic compare with the rest of New Jersey?

Atlantic is lower than the New Jersey median of 9,141.
